Output 2676a3f173a046f8c8ce75d42a7a2ea0c75846208e307fa2359d447385241bf9:0

value
6295293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89bd0c99faa01e59bab8e5e476a563adfb1848a3 OP_EQUAL
address
3EFJyCFxxkH7VmhirSnm9Dpdo1jDZ8qMyN
transaction
2676a3f173a046f8c8ce75d42a7a2ea0c75846208e307fa2359d447385241bf9